Methodology: How We Ranked the Best Solar Companies in Lawrence
EcoWatch's solar experts analyzed each solar company in Lawrence based on criteria such as its reputation in the industry, customer reviews, services, warranty coverage and financing. Using this solar methodology, we used the data we collected to rate and rank each company and narrow down our picks for the best solar companies in Lawrence
Below are some the criteria we examined specifically for Indiana solar companies
- Brand reputation and certifications (20%): We take each company's Better Business Bureau (BBB) score into consideration, as well as how long the installer has been in business (at least 5 years is required, 10 preferred) and what type of solar certifications it holds.
- Customer reviews (20%): Trust is a top priority at EcoWatch, so we take customer experience under close consideration. We scour different review sites and customer testimonials when ranking our top solar companies, checking sites such as Trustpilot and Google Reviews. We also consider any potential complaints or lawsuits filed against these companies and award or remove points accordingly.
- Warranty (20%): A company earns a perfect score in this category if it offers 25-year warranties that cover performance, product and workmanship. The industry standard that we measure companies against is 25-year product and performance warranties, along with a 10-year workmanship warranty. We also look closely into the track record of the post-installation support each company provides in terms of honoring its contracts
- Solar services (10%): All of the companies we review install solar panels, but we award companies higher points if they offer additional services for customers, like battery installation, energy-efficiency audits, and EV chargers.
- Pricing and financing (10%): It's hard to get exact quotes for solar projects, but we use marketplace research to determine how each company prices its equipment and installation services. Additionally, companies that offer more help for panel financing — like in-house loans, leases, or PPAs — score higher than those that don't.
- Availability (10%): The bigger the service area, the higher the company will score.
- Transparency and accessibility (5%): Solar installers that offer free consultations and easy contact methods score higher in this category.
- Environmental, social and corporate governance factors (5%): A company earns a perfect score in this category if it offers public data disclosure, addresses end-of-life (EOL) products or processes, and demonstrates a commitment to uplifting the communities that it serves.
The Cost and Benefits of Solar in Lawrence
Solar panels run off a free energy source — the sun — but to take advantage of this you will first need to pay to install your panels.There are a few factors you should take into consideration when determining how much it will cost and how much you can save, including:
- Incentives: One thing that can reduce the cost of your solar project is the solar investment tax credit (ITC), which is a tax credit that’s equal to a percentage of the project cost. You can also save a decent amount of money on your utility bills, which can lead to an average of $17,000 of savings over 20 years.
- Typical energy usage: The more electricity your household uses on average and the higher your current electricity bills are, the more likely you'll benefit from making the switch to solar.
- The type of solar panels you’re thinking of getting: More high-tech panels cost more, so that will shape your budget for your solar project.
- Average daily sunlight: Since Lawrence gets a decent amount of average daily sunlight, your solar panels can generally generate enough energy to power your whole home, which influences how much your electricity bills will be.
Thanks to solar panels now being cheaper than ever as well as several solar incentives, they are a sound investment for many homeowners.

What is the negative environmental impact of making solar panels?
Manufacturing solar panels uses chemicals and produces toxic waste that can be bad for the environment, which is the main drawback of solar panels.
How long does it take to see a return on your investment after installing solar panels?
The average payback period for solar panel installation is about 16.4 years, but the exact period depends on local electricity costs, incentives and net metering programs.
What is the efficiency of solar panels?
Solar panel efficiency is the amount of solar energy that is converted into electricity. Most panels today have an efficiency rating between 15 and 20%. If your panels are more efficient, you'll need less of them for your home's energy needs.
